Vegan French Dressing - small batch
Tempt your taste buds with a plant-based twist on a classic French salad dressing. Rock your salads with this delicious Vegan French Dressing.

Ingredients
6
tablespoons
olive oil
2
tablespoons
white wine vinegar
1
tablespoon
Dijon mustard
¼
clove
garlic
2
teaspoons
dried parsley
1
pinch
salt & pepper
Get Recipe Ingredients
Instructions
Add all the ingredients to a blender, food processor and blend.
If you are using a clean jar jar, make sure the lid is on and shake like mad to emulsify the dressing.
Taste to check the seasoning.
Enjoy!
Notes
Thin it
- You can thin the dressing by adding some olive oil or water and blending again. Water actually works well to thin a dressing.
Temperature
- Take out the fridge a few minutes before you serve it to take the chill off it.
Store homemade salad dressing in a clean jam jar or a bottle with a tight lid
. It will keep in the fridge for up to 1 week.
Shake
- shake it well before serving as it will settle in the fridge.
